UK-EU trade and co-operation agreement (TCA)
An association agreement between the EU and Euratom, and the UK, which establishes the basis for a broad UK-EU relationship and provides a framework for co-operation in areas of mutual interest. The TCA:
Applied on a provisional basis from the end of the transition period and entered into force at 11.00 pm (UK time) on 30 April 2021.
Includes provisions on trade in goods and in services, investment, digital trade, intellectual property, public procurement, subsidy control, labour and environmental standards, aviation and road transport, energy, fisheries, social security co-ordination, law enforcement and judicial co-operation in criminal matters, thematic co-operation, participation in Union programmes, institutional arrangements, dispute settlement and safeguards (see Practice notes, Future UK-EU relationship agreements and UK-EU trade and co-operation agreement: overview of Part Two on trade and other arrangements).
